Had my first problem with the Landy today, engine seemed to be running fine, left it ticking over walked away for a couple of mins came back and it had stopped, it would not restart, no spark. Got her towed home and then tried it again, low and behold it fired up? ticked over for about a 2 mins and then stopped, like the ignition was off and would not fire again, left it for a few mins and it fired up again?

Its an electronic coil on a RR Lucas amplifier, SU carbs. all the wiring is okay I know that for sure.
I cant say I have ever seen a coil act like that before has anyone else?

Sort of similar to what happened to me. I pulled the king lead from the bottom of the coil and some oil came out. The coil was breaking down as it got warmer. A new coil sorted it.

Yeah i was thinking the same thing, I did find some info on a jad website that the ignition amp can also cause the same problem (Lucas constant energy unit)

I am a bit dubious about the dizzy coil amp reliabilty now and was thinking of choping it all for a Mallory setup but never having used them before I have no idea how good they are.
